The AstIf nodes conditional on events being triggered used to be created in V3Clock. Now it is in V3Sched*, in order to avoid having to pass AstActive in CFunc or MTask bodies. No functional change intended, some improved optimization due to simplifying timing triggers that were previously missed, also fixes what seems like a bug in the original timing commit code.
